When it comes to finding cheap car insurance in Tillamook, there are several trending unique topics in auto insurance right now that drivers should be aware of. These topics include:
1. Usage-based insurance: Usage-based insurance, also known as telematics, is a growing trend in auto insurance that uses technology to track a driver’s behavior on the road. By monitoring factors such as speed, braking, and mileage, insurance companies can offer personalized rates based on individual driving habits.
2. Pay-per-mile insurance: Pay-per-mile insurance is another innovative approach to auto insurance that allows drivers to pay for coverage based on the number of miles they drive. This can be a cost-effective option for drivers who don’t use their vehicles frequently or have short commutes.
3. Bundling discounts: Many insurance companies offer discounts for bundling multiple policies, such as auto and home insurance. By combining your coverage with the same provider, you may be able to save money on your premiums.
4. Autonomous vehicles: With the rise of autonomous vehicles, insurance companies are exploring new ways to underwrite policies for self-driving cars. This includes considering factors such as technology malfunctions and liability in the event of an accident involving an autonomous vehicle.
5. Cyber insurance: As vehicles become more connected to the internet and vulnerable to cyber attacks, some insurance companies are offering cyber insurance to protect against data breaches and other cyber threats. This coverage can be a valuable addition for drivers with smart vehicles.
6. Ride-sharing insurance: For drivers who participate in ride-sharing services such as Uber or Lyft, ride-sharing insurance is essential. This coverage provides protection when using your vehicle for commercial purposes and may be required by the ride-sharing company.
In addition to these unique topics, there are common questions that drivers in Tillamook may have when it comes to obtaining cheap car insurance. Here are 14 common questions with answers to help guide you in your search for affordable coverage:
1. What factors affect my car insurance premiums in Tillamook?
Several factors can affect your car insurance premiums in Tillamook, including your age, driving record, type of vehicle, coverage options, and location.
2. How can I lower my car insurance premiums in Tillamook?
To lower your car insurance premiums in Tillamook, consider factors such as bundling policies, maintaining a clean driving record, opting for a higher deductible, and shopping around for quotes.
3. What type of coverage do I need in Tillamook?
The type of coverage you need in Tillamook will depend on factors such as your vehicle type, driving habits, and budget. Common coverage options include liability, collision, comprehensive, and u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age.
4. Are there discounts available for car insurance in Tillamook?
Many insurance companies in Tillamook offer discounts for factors such as safe driving, bundling policies, anti-theft devices, and driver education courses. Be sure to ask your insurer about available discounts.
5. Can I switch car insurance providers in Tillamook?
Yes, you can switch car insurance providers in Tillamook at any time. Be sure to compare quotes from multiple insurers to find the best rates and coverage options for your needs.
6. Do I need special insurance for a leased vehicle in Tillamook?
If you lease a vehicle in Tillamook, you may be required to carry specific insurance coverage, such as gap insurance, to protect against financial losses in the event of an accident or theft.
7. How does my credit score affect my car insurance premiums in Tillamook?
In Tillamook, your credit score may impact your car insurance premiums, as insurers use this information to determine your risk level as a driver. Be sure to maintain good credit to potentially lower your rates.
8. What is the minimum car insurance requirement in Tillamook?
In Tillamook, drivers are required to carry liability insurance to cover bodily injury and property damage in the event of an accident. The minimum coverage limits may vary, so be sure to check with your insurer for specific requirements.
9. Can I add additional drivers to my car insurance policy in Tillamook?
Yes, you can add additional drivers to your car insurance policy in Tillamook, such as family members or roommates who share your vehicle. Be sure to inform your insurer of all drivers to ensure proper coverage.
10. What should I do if I’m involved in a car accident in Tillamook?
If you’re involved in a car accident in Tillamook, be sure to document the scene, exchange information with other drivers, and contact your insurance provider to file a claim. It’s important to report the accident as soon as possible to start the claims process.
11. How does my vehicle type affect my car insurance premiums in Tillamook?
Your vehicle type can impact your car insurance premiums in Tillamook, as factors such as make, model, age, and safety features may influence the cost of coverage. Be sure to provide accurate information about your vehicle when obtaining quotes.
12. Are there penalties for driving without insurance in Tillamook?
Driving without insurance in Tillamook is illegal and can result in penalties such as fines, license suspension, and vehicle impoundment. It’s essential to carry the required coverage to protect yourself and others on the road.
13. Can I get temporary car insurance in Tillamook?
If you need temporary coverage for a rental car or short-term use, you may be able to purchase temporary car insurance in Tillamook. Be sure to check with your insurer or rental agency for options and requirements.
14. How can I find the best car insurance rates in Tillamook?
To find the best car insurance rates in Tillamook, compare quotes from multiple insurers, consider factors such as coverage options and discounts, and work with an agent to customize a policy that fits your needs and budget.
